Country Chicken Soup: A recipe that blends tradition with authentic taste

Country chicken soup is an emblematic dish in numerous culinary cultures, often associated with Sunday meals when the family gathers around the table. This simple recipe will not only fill your home with enticing aromas but will also provide a nourishing and comforting meal. In this version, we will use fresh, flavorful ingredients that transform the soup into an unforgettable culinary experience.

Preparation time: 15 minutes
Cooking time: 45 minutes
Total time: 1 hour
Number of servings: 6

Ingredients
- 1 country chicken breast (approximately 1,300 g)
- 2 large onions
- 2 carrots
- 1 red bell pepper
- 1 yellow bell pepper
- 1/4 pack of spaghetti or noodles
- 200-300 ml sour borscht
- 3 liters of water
- A bunch of celery leaves
- 2 tablespoons of dried parsley
- Salt and pepper to taste

Step by step

1. Preparing the meat
Start by deboning the chicken breast. This step may seem intimidating, but with a little patience, you will be able to obtain tender, boneless meat. After deboning the breast, wash the meat under cold running water and cut it into medium-sized cubes.

2. Boiling the meat
In a large pot, add the 3 liters of water and put in the cut chicken breast along with the bone from the breast. Bringing the water to a boil is essential, so make sure you have the right heat. Once the water starts to boil, I recommend removing the foam that forms on the surface. This step will help achieve a clear and tasty soup.

3. Adding the vegetables
After about 30 minutes of boiling, add the vegetables. Cut the onions and carrots into small cubes, and the bell peppers into strips. These vegetables not only add texture but also a rich aromatic profile. Finally, taste the soup and adjust the salt and pepper to your liking.

4. The sour borscht
After the vegetables have boiled for about 10 minutes, add the hot sour borscht to give a delicious taste to the soup. If you don't have borscht, you can use lemon juice or vinegar, but borscht remains the classic choice that offers an authentic flavor.

5. Finishing the soup
Once you have added the borscht, let the soup come to a boil. After this, turn off the heat and add the pasta or noodles. These will absorb the flavors from the soup and cook quickly. Finally, sprinkle the chopped celery leaves and dried parsley for an extra touch of freshness.

6. Serving
Serve the soup hot, along with a slice of fresh bread. A drop of sour cream on top can add a creamy note, but it is optional. You can also add some slices of hot pepper if you like spicy food.

Useful tips
- Choosing the meat: Country chicken breast is recommended for a more robust flavor, but you can also use store-bought chicken if you don't have access to a local one.
- The vegetables: You can vary the types of vegetables by using zucchini, peas, or potatoes, depending on the season and preferences.
- The taste of the soup: If you prefer a more sour soup, you can add more borscht. Try to adjust the taste at the end after you have added the pasta.

Frequently asked questions
1. Can I use frozen chicken?
Yes, but make sure to let it thaw completely before adding it to the pot.

2. How can I store the soup?
The soup keeps well in the refrigerator for 2-3 days or can be frozen for later use.

Calories and nutritional benefits
This chicken soup is not only tasty but also nourishing. A serving contains about 200-250 calories, depending on the amount of pasta added. It is rich in proteins, vitamins, and minerals, making it ideal for a healthy meal.
